"It takes an organization to avoid anarchy." This was the statement of the president of the special delegation (PDS) of Antananarivo, Feno Ralambomanana. Nearly a month after his appointment to this post, the new edile of the capital is working to cope with a growing deterioration of the urban organization despite the waves of protest that continue to rise, especially among street merchants.
